A Portrait of Caucasian Dignity: Grigory Gagarin’s “Caucasian Prince”

Grigory Grigorievich Gagarin (1810-1893) stands as a singular figure in 19th-century Russian art – an artist who seamlessly blended artistic vision with administrative duty, diplomacy, and a profound engagement with the cultural landscape of his time. Born into the noble Rurikid family, Gagarin’s early life was shaped by aristocratic privilege but fueled by an unexpected passion for painting, nurtured under the tutelage of Karl Briullov, arguably Russia's foremost painter of the era. This confluence of influences would ultimately define his artistic trajectory and solidify his legacy as a chronicler of Caucasian culture.
  • Subject Matter: The artwork depicts a Caucasian prince—a man embodying regal authority and tradition—seated on a simple earthen ground, offering a striking contrast between grandeur and humility.
  • Style & Technique: Gagarin’s masterful brushwork exemplifies Romanticism's preoccupation with emotion and dramatic landscapes. Employing oil paint on canvas, he achieved remarkable tonal depth and textural richness, capturing the subtle nuances of light and shadow to convey both physical presence and psychological character.
The painting’s genesis lies in Gagarin’s formative years spent in Tiflis (modern Tbilisi), Georgia—a region undergoing significant transformation under Mikhail Vorontsov's patronage. Recognizing the importance of documenting Georgian heritage, Gagarin undertook ambitious projects aimed at revitalizing artistic traditions and celebrating local identity. Notably, he spearheaded the construction of a theater mirroring Pompey Theatre’s architectural splendor and meticulously frescoed the Sioni Cathedral, restoring faded murals that spoke to centuries of Georgian history. This dedication to cultural preservation is mirrored in his meticulous sketches and drawings—a testament to his keen observation skills and artistic sensitivity.
  • Historical Context: Created in 1855 during a period of Russian expansion into the Caucasus, “Caucasian Prince” reflects anxieties about preserving cultural traditions amidst imperial ambition. Gagarin’s work serves as an important visual record of Georgian society at the time—a glimpse into aristocratic life and artistic endeavors.
  • Symbolism: The prince's posture exudes confidence yet is grounded in the earth, symbolizing stability and connection to tradition. The gold trim on his robe subtly hints at royal status while simultaneously emphasizing the enduring values of nobility and dignity.

Biografija umetnika

early life and education

grigory grigorievich gagarin, a russian painter, major general, and administrator, was born in 1810 in saint petersburg to the noble rurikid princely gagarin family. his father, prince grigory ivanovich gagarin, was a russian diplomat in france and later the ambassador to italy. despite not receiving a formal artistic education, grigory took private lessons from the renowned russian painter karl briullov.

artistic career and notable works

grigory's artistic career is marked by his association with prominent literary figures of his time, including alexander pushkin and mikhail lermontov. he illustrated pushkin's works, such as "the queen of spades" and "the tale of tsar saltan." some of his notable paintings include:

military and diplomatic career

grigory served as a russian diplomat in paris, rome, and constantinople, with a notable stint in munich. his return to russia in 1839 marked a significant shift in his career, as he became involved in various administrative roles. key points: * born into the noble rurikid princely gagarin family * trained under karl briullov despite not receiving formal artistic education * associated with alexander pushkin and mikhail lermontov * served as a diplomat in several european cities * notable for his portraits of regional figures and groups

legacy

grigory grigorievich gagarin's legacy is multifaceted, reflecting both his artistic talents and his diplomatic service. his paintings offer a unique window into the cultures and landscapes he encountered during his lifetime.
